SCOPE
1.1 This specification covers foaming agents specifically formulated for making preformed foam for use in the production of cellular concrete.
1.2 The function of this specification is to provide the means for evaluating the performance of a specific foaming agent. This is accomplished by using the foaming agent in making a standard cellular concrete test batch (see Test Method C796) from which test specimens are cast. Then, significant properties of the concrete are determined by tests and compared with the requirements of Section 3.
1.3 The values stated in either SI units or inch-pound units are to be regarded separately as standard. The values stated in each system may not be exact equivalents; therefore, each system shall be used independently of the other. Combining values from the two systems may result in non-conformance with the standard.

Key Topics
- Scope of Standardization: This specification applies exclusively to foaming agents designed to create preformed foam used in the production of cellular concrete.
- Performance Evaluation: The standard outlines procedures for evaluating foaming agent performance using a controlled cellular concrete test batch. Properties measured include:
- Density after pumping and oven-dry density for different cement types
- Compressive strength and tensile splitting strength
- Water absorption
- Loss of air during pumping
- Unit Systems: Both SI (metric) and inch-pound (imperial) units are specified as standard, but values in each unit system must be used independently to ensure compliance.
- Referenced Test Methods: The performance and conformity assessment require the use of ASTM C796, which details the methodology for testing foaming agents in cellular concrete.
